Creamy Mushroom Casserole
Mushrooms baked with cream, kaşar cheese and butter in a clay pot – a warm starter from Istanbul's meyhane kitchens.

Ingredients · for 4 servings
600 g mixed mushrooms
1 onion
2 cloves garlic
40 g butter
200 ml cream
150 g kaşar cheese
1 tsp thyme
2 tbsp parsley
Salt, pepper
Instructions
- Wipe the mushrooms clean with a cloth and cut into thick slices; finely dice the onion, chop the garlic, grate the cheese and chop the parsley. Preheat the oven to 200 °C.
- Let the butter foam in a pan and fry the mushrooms over high heat for 5–6 min. until the liquid has evaporated and the edges brown.
- Add the onion and garlic and sauté for another 3 min. until the onion is translucent; season with salt, pepper and thyme.
- Pour in the cream and simmer uncovered for 3–4 min. until the sauce thickens slightly and just covers the mushrooms.
- Divide the mixture among four small clay pots (or a baking dish), sprinkle with the kaşar cheese and bake for 12–15 min. until the cheese has melted and turned golden at the edges.
- Sprinkle with parsley and serve piping hot in the pots with warm flatbread.
